They left me for dead, but jokes on them I've already died before. The blood I've shed is now replaced by vengeance and she sets my body ablaze. I have to play this game smart though. I'm no longer a Thorn, no longer a part of what my birthright dictates I should be, but that doesn't mean I can't wreak havoc on those who've destroyed what's left of my humanity. But new secrets are revealed and loyalties are tested and I find myself questioning everything I thought I knew, including the biggest betrayal at the hands of my lovers.
